Top honeymoon places in Jammu & Kashmir:

Jammu & Kashmir's stunning beauty and charm completely warrant its nickname, "Paradise on Earth." It is one of the most romantic places in the country and a popular holiday spot for couples. Here are the most popular honeymoon destinations in Jammu and Kashmir that you should consider:

Srinagar

Srinagar is often ranked top among the most popular honeymoon spots in Jammu and Kashmir. It strikes the perfect mix between modern cityscapes, historical monuments, religious sites, natural features, and so on. There are numerous romantic activities to do with your significant other in Srinagar, Jammu and Kashmir, including shopping for souvenirs, sleeping on a houseboat, meandering around the Mughal-era gardens, and enjoying a Shikara ride.

Pahalgam

Another favorite honeymoon destination is the beautiful hill town of Jammu and Kashmir. The region's natural beauty and serenity have helped it become one of the most popular Kashmir honeymoon destinations. The availability of pleasant experiences and nearby tourist attractions, such as Sheshnag Lake, Lidder River, Chadanwari, Baisaran Valley, and so on, has also enhanced the region's tourism experience.

Sonmarg

Sonamarg is one of Jammu & Kashmir's most unique and picturesque honeymoon spots. For reference, the Gulmarg Sonmarg travel route is around 120 kilometers long, whereas the road distance between Pahalgam and Sonmarg is approximately 160 kilometers. Nestled at an elevation of 2,730 meters, the area is recognized for its huge green fields, lush forests, rushing river streams, and magnificent lakes against a backdrop of snow-covered mountains. Sonamarg offers a variety of entertaining activities for you and your loved one, in addition to sightseeing. Sonamarg's principal attractions include trekking, Satsar Lake, Gangabal Lake, and Thajiwas Glacier.

Patnitop

Patnitop is a hill station in Jammu and Kashmir that attracts honeymooners owing to its magnificent natural beauty and plenty of leisure activities. You can spend a few days with your loved one in its tranquil settings and explore nearby tourist attractions such as Shiva Ghar, Sudh Mahadev Temple, Naag Mandir, Madhatop, Nathatop, and others.

Gurez Valley

Gurez Valley is a renowned honeymoon spot in Jammu & Kashmir. Rich flora, majestic mountains, and smooth-flowing rivers all contribute to the region's enchanting beauty and quiet environs. Aside from exploring the area with your loved one, this valley provides a good glimpse of the stunning Nanga Parbat.

Adventure Activities to do in Jammu and Kashmir:

Jammu and Kashmir is also one of India's premier adventure tourism destinations. People visiting Jammu & Kashmir can participate in a range of fascinating activities, including:

Horse riding:

Horseback riding is an excellent activity to undertake on your Jammu and Kashmir visit, especially in Gulmarg, Sonamarg, Srinagar, and Lolab Valley. Individuals can, however, travel to Pahalgam for a thrilling horseback riding experience. Horseback riding along the Pahalgam to Mini Switzerland trail is one of the most beautiful and exciting activities in Jammu and Kashmir, and it is a must-do adventure.



Ziplining:

Ziplining is a thrilling, fast-paced action that visitors to Jammu and Kashmir can experience. It is a pleasant activity that does not take much skill and simply requires gliding through the air at high speeds while connected to a long steel cable via harness. It is typically a safe pastime and provides a fantastic opportunity to admire and experience the region's natural beauty. Pahalgam and Patnitop are two of Jammu and Kashmir's top zipline destinations.

River Rafting:

While in Jammu and Kashmir, consider going on an exhilarating river rafting excursion. It is a fast-paced recreational activity in which you negotiate a turbulent river on an inflatable raft with paddles. There are various river rafting destinations in the region, but the Sindh River near Sonamarg and the Lidder River near Pahalgam are the most famous.

ATV riding:

ATV riding is another fun sport that visitors to Jammu and Kashmir may take part in. ATV stands for all-terrain vehicle, which is a specially designed four-wheel bike that can be ridden at high speeds over a range of challenging terrain. Gulmarg is an excellent site for ATV riding adventures in Jammu and Kashmir.

Food to Eat in Jammu and Kashmir

Food in Jammu and Kashmir has a rich culinary history. Its cuisine is tasty and healthful, with an abundance of desi ghee, Jammu and Kashmiri red chili, and garam masala. Here are some splurge-worthy meals to try while visiting Jammu & Kashmir.



Rogan Josh – Meat lovers are in for a treat. Chunky lamb is marinated in yogurt and topped with ground spices and brown onions. This is normally eaten with steamed rice or the traditional Indian flatbread, roti. So, on your Jammu and Kashmir tour, make sure to experience this culinary delicacy.                                                                 

Modur Pulav: Looking for a sweet treat? This Jammu and Kashmiri dish consists of sweetened rice cooked in ghee, milk, and sugar, decorated with saffron and dry fruits. You won't be able to stop at just one serving when it comes in an attractive small clay pot! It is a must-try for tourists and travelers visiting Jammu and Kashmir.

Lyodur Tschaman - Jammu & Kashmir cuisine also has a variety of delicious vegetarian meals. Fluffy cottage cheese is cooked in a delectable creamy turmeric sauce. Enjoy this dish with bread, roti, or steaming rice during your Jammu & Kashmir tour.

Dum Olav – Dum Olav is a tasty native delicacy that you should have during your Jammu and Kashmir vacation. This hearty dish is made with potatoes soaked in yogurt, ginger powder, and fennel, then topped with hot spices. This meal pairs best with roti or naan.
